Black Star Canyon Inoceramus-Acila Paleocommunity (Cretaceous of the United States)

Also known as Locality BS-2

Where: Orange County, California (33.8° N, 117.7° W: paleocoordinates 39.4° N, 87.1° W)

• coordinate based on nearby landmark

• small collection-level geographic resolution

When: Holz Shale Member (Ladd Formation), Campanian (83.6 - 72.1 Ma)

• from "about 1 m of strata"

• group of beds-level stratigraphic resolution

Environment/lithology: lagoonal; lithified siltstone and lithified shale

• "in restricted marine water at shallow depths... perhaps the result of a lagoonal setting"

•the Holz Shale in general is "in a shallow marine setting, including prodelta, lagoonal and bay environments"

• "Brown to gray siltstone and shale with interbedded lenses of stringers of limestone, conglomerate, and sandstone"

•apparently well lithified because strata were "broken" and "disarticulated" during collection

Size class: macrofossils

Collection methods: surface (in situ),

• "selective collecting, by breaking the strata at the site"

•collections apparently are at the California State University at Fullerton

Primary reference: F. A. Sundberg. 1980. Late Cretaceous paleoecology of the Holz Shale, Orange County, California. Journal of Paleontology 54(4):840-857 [J. Alroy/J. Alroy]more details

Purpose of describing collection: paleoecologic analysis
